When choosing a place to sleep it is important to not only consider the quality of the hostel, but also what activities are planned. The five main areas for hostels in Perth are in the Central Business District, Northbridge, Fremantle, Scarborough and Cottesloe.
Those travellers who want to be in the centre of the major shops, restaurants and nightclubs will want to stay in the CBD or Northbridge. The main transportation station is between the CBD and Northbridge, making it very easy to travel out to the beach or around to the other areas.
